Factory Price Regenerative Load Bank - Stainless Steel Resistor Cabinet – Wepower Detail:

█ Product Features

1. Power Range:20KW~200KW

2. Voltage Range:<1500V

3. Resistance Range:0.1Ω~150Ω

4. Dielectric Strength:AC3500V 50Hz 5S

5. Ingress Protection:IP00/IP23

6. Element Material:stainless steel

7. Temperature Coefficient:≤1400ppm/℃

8. Vibration:0.5g

9. Advantage:High-power

10. Disadvantage:Less Resistance、High Temperature Coefficient

11. For Crane, elevator, loading test

Stainless Steel resistor Cabinet ,endurable & efficient;

High temperature withstand ability , as high as 1200℃;

IP54 protection.

Anti-corrosion SS tube resistor,high fusion point nickel-chromium resistance wire ,fusion point>1200℃;

Anti-corrosion SS304 resistor seal tube ,high temperature magnesium oxidant stuffing between resistance and seal tube ;

High temperature magnesium has good insulation and heat conducting function .

Function of Stainless Steel resistor Cabinet:

suitable for harsh application area , long lasting working time .

Application of Stainless Steel resistor Cabinet:

crane , industrial elevator, hoist braking purpose.
